ROAR Games, a new development studio from the people behind the US-based CGI studio ZHEESHEE is currently making Tenet of the Spark. Based on ZHEESHEE’s own short “The Spark”, This ambitious cinematic corridor-fighter tells the story of a young boxer who must learnt the truth about himself through embodying his ancestors.
Channeling more technical fighting games like SIFU, there’s a heavy focus on meaty hand-to-hand combat. Will can shift through overlapping realities on command to get the edge in a fight, with his Viking ancestor able to slam down onto enemies with his massive hammer or his Aztec counterpart to attack from height or at a distance.






The art direction is brilliant, with Will’s modern era filled with punchy graffiti and trash lining the alleyways Will fights through, only to seamlessly transition into a mountainous tundra or ancient Aztecan ruins.
